Understanding Garage Door Springs
- Learn about the different types of garage door springs: torsion and extension springs. Understand how each type functions and its significance for your garage door in areas like Los Angeles and Northridge. Recognize signs of a broken spring, similar to issue in opening the door or visible wear.
Garage door springs are usually one of two types: torsion springs or extension springs. Torsion springs are mounted above the garage door, whereas extension springs are positioned on both facet. Both types are under significant tension and may pose a danger if mishandled. Steps to Fix a Broken Garage Door Spring
1. Disconnect the Garage Door from the Opener
- Pull the emergency release wire to disconnect the garage door from the opener. Manually carry the door a few inches and check if it is balanced.
Before you begin, it’s important to disconnect the garage door from the opener mechanism. Pull the emergency launch cord, which allows you to function the door manually. Lift the door barely to see if it remains in place. If it falls, there is probably a major issue with the springs, requiring immediate consideration.
2. Assess the Existing Springs
- Inspect both springs for any indicators of harm or wear. Look for gaps, rust, or stretching.
Inspect each the torsion and extension springs rigorously. Look for visible signs of injury, similar to rust, breaks, or extreme stretching. If you find a broken spring, you'll need to replace it immediately for safety reasons.
